Crenature - Definition, Meaning & Synonyms - Vocabulary.com
Definitions of crenature. noun. one of a series of rounded projections (or the notches between them) formed by curves along an edge (as the edge of a leaf or piece of cloth or the margin of a shell or a shriveled red blood cell observed in a hypertonic solution etc.) synonyms: crenation, crenel, crenelle, scallop.
